024 - Is it art or can it be thrown away? Archiving with SAP EWM

In the world of warehouse management, efficiency and performance are paramount. Yet, one topic often remains in the shadows of project planning and daily operations: archiving in SAP Extended Warehouse Management (EWM). While tidying up may not be anyone’s favorite task—whether at home or in IT—it’s essential for maintaining a clean, performant, and future-proof SAP system.

In this SAP EWM Podcast episode we explore the importance of archiving in SAP EWM, what data should be archived or deleted, and how it ties into broader concepts like Clean Core and compliance.
